
Sweet, crunchy, and deeply aromatic, these maple-glazed roasted nuts hit every note you want from a snack or party appetizer. Cashews, pecans, almonds, and walnuts get tossed in a glossy blend of maple syrup, agave nectar, and melted coconut oil before heading into the oven, where the glaze slowly caramelizes into a lacquered, crisp shell. A pinch of cinnamon and sea salt keeps things balanced, while optional cayenne adds a gentle kick that makes it genuinely hard to stop snacking. The whole thing is completely plant-based, so there's no butter, no honey, and absolutely nothing from the sea — just wholesome pantry staples doing beautiful work together. Spreading the nuts in a single layer and stirring halfway through is the key move here; it ensures even roasting and that signature deep-amber color without any burning. Once they cool on the pan, the glaze sets into a satisfying crackle that makes every handful feel a little indulgent. Store them in an airtight container and they're ready whenever a craving strikes.

Preheat the oven to 325°F (165°C). Line a rimmed baking sheet with parchment paper.
In a medium mixing bowl, stir together the maple syrup, agave nectar, melted coconut oil, ground cinnamon, fine sea salt, and cayenne and vanilla powder, if using, until combined.
